A search warrant is a legally binding document that must be acquired by law enforcement officers or investigators before they can open up, enter and search a building. There are various types of search warrants.
Standard search and seize warrants require that law enforcement officers have to identify themselves and allow the occupant a significant amount of time to react. They'd have to knock or ring the doorbell in this situation.
Because law enforcement agents began to see the continued destruction of evidence before they got in, it necessitated the design of another kind of search warrant - the No-Knock Warrant.
By comparison, Allison and Robert will enter the suspect's house violently without advance warning with a No-Knock Warrant, so that if there is any evidence that can be used against the suspect, they will confiscate and protect it to prevent it from being destroyed.

fruits and vegetables are full of energy. Energy in the form of glucose. The energy from sunlight is briefly held in NADPH and ATP, which is needed to drive the formation of sugars such as glucose.
As Melvin Calvin discovered, carbon fixation is the first step of a cycle. The Calvin cycle transfers energy in small, controlled steps. Each step pushes molecules uphill in terms of energy content. Recall that in the electron transport chain, excited electrons lose energy to NADPH and ATP. In the Calvin cycle, NADPH and ATP formed in the light reactions lose their stored chemical energy to build glucose.
